Carley DeFranco

Described as “sunny,” “supple,” and “soaring,” soprano Carley DeFranco gives meaningful and embodied performances. Recent projects include the titular role in Theodora with Bach Charlotte and the west coast premiere of Lost Birds (Christopher Tin) with VOCES 8. A former Lorraine Hunt Lieberson Fellow with Emmanuel Music, Carley has sung over 100 Bach cantatas in their weekly series and has been a soloist and chorister in all of their recent concert and staged productions. She is a guest soloist with many choruses, orchestras, and early and chamber music organizations throughout the US and regularly performs with Boston Lyric Opera, Oregon Bach Festival, Sarasa Ensemble, Musicians of the Old Post Road, Handel & Haydn Society, Ensemble Altera, and the Harvard Choruses. A loving teacher, Carley is the founder of DeFranco Music LLC, which partners with local schools to offer music lessons, and a Voice Instructor in Harvard University’s Holden Voice Program.
